Pantothenic Acid - CORRECT ANSWER -Water soluble Vitamin
Conzyme A
Pantothenic Acid Deficiency - CORRECT ANSWER -Dermatitis, loss of hair, greying of hair
Zinc - CORRECT ANSWER -Mineral
Component of several enzyme systems
Zinc Deficiency - CORRECT ANSWER -
Poor hair or feather development and slipping of wool, rough or thickened skin in swine
Vitamin E - CORRECT ANSWER -Fat Soluble Vitamin
Antioxidant
As vitamin A content is increased in ration, so should vitamin E content
Vitamin E Deficiency - CORRECT ANSWER -Muscle Dystrophy
Magnesium - CORRECT ANSWER -Enzyme activator primarily in glycolytic system
Magnesium Deficiency - CORRECT ANSWER -Vasodilation, hyperirritability with convulsions
